
Inca Plum
Inca plum is a medium size, heart-shaped variety with rich, crisp flesh and golden skin skin with red specks and blush when fully ripe. Pleasant acid/sugar balance. Introduced by Luther Burbank in 1919. Ripens early to mid August.
